Southern Research is a nonprofit, translational scientific research organization with an 80-year legacy of moving science through drug discovery, drug development and environmental health. This legacy includes helping shape modern cancer treatment practices by developing seven FDA-approved cancer drugs and co-creating a COVID-19 vaccine currently in clinical trials. These innovations are made possible because of our greatest assets, our people that move science every day at every level of Southern Research.

Since breaking ground in the summer of 2022, we've been eagerly anticipating the opening of our new state-of-the-art facility—set to open in July 2025! ? This 135,000-square-foot high-rise addition will feature four floors of wet labs and offices designed to extend our research capabilities, enable new initiatives, and support continued expansion. It will be a welcome addition to our campus, first established 80 years ago, and continues to demonstrate our commitment to growth, progress, and a brighter future.

We are very excited to share that the U.S. Economic Development Administration has awarded the Birmingham Biotechnology Hub $44M across five projects! This is a outstanding team win for many partner organizations across Birmingham and the state of Alabama. The federal grant funding will be integral to driving our city’s biotech economy forward and increasing diverse representation in clinical genomic data and clinical trials.
